The document defines and discusses the theological concept of propitiation. It explains that propitiation refers to appeasing an offended party to regain their favor, such as by offering a gift. In Christianity, propitiation refers to Jesus' sacrificial death on the cross, which satisfied God's justice and turned away his wrath against humanity for their sins. Through Jesus' blood, God's mercy is now freely available to all who accept it, and believers no longer need to fear God's anger or wrath against them.

In Jude 17-23 Jude shifts from piling up examples of false teachers from the Old Testament to a series of practical exhortations that flow from apostolic instruction. He preserves for us what may well have been part of the apostolic catechism for the first generation of Christ-followers. In these instructions Jude exhorts the believer to deal with 3 different groups of people: scoffers who are "devoid of the Spirit", believers who have come under the influence of scoffers and believers who are so entrenched in false teaching that they need rescue and pose some real spiritual risk for the rescuer. In all of this Jude emphasizes Jesus' call to rescue straying sheep, leaving the 99 safely behind and pursuing the 1.

3. II. DEFINITION:
Propitiation is an action meant to regain
someone's favor or make up for
something you did wrong. Propitiation
comes from a form of the Latin verb
"propitiare," which means “to appease.”
If you’re doing something in
propitiation, that’s your basic goal: to
regain favor.
4. A. TO ATTEMPT TO
TURN AWAY
ANGER BY
OFFERING A GIFT
TO THE OFFENDED
PARTY.
5. B. SOME EXAMPLES:
•JACOB sending gifts to pacify
his brother ESAU. (Gen. 32)
•A HUSBAND placating an
offended WIFE.
•A PAGAN worshiper placating
an angry GOD.
8. THE DAY OF
ATONEMENT
•The High Priest offered the
blood of a GOAT on the MERCY
SEAT of the Ark of the
Covenant.
• This offering served to forgive
the sins of all Israel for a YEAR.
9. JESUS DIED ON THE
CROSS AND SHED HIS
BLOOD.
•Jesus was our HIGH
PRIEST - Hebrews 2:17
•Jesus was our SACRIFICE-
1 John 2:2
10. IV. THE EFFECTS OF
PROPITIATION
• God’s JUSTICE is now satisfied.
• God’s WRATH has been turned
away.
• God’s MERCY is freely available
to anyone who desires it.
